Common Seligman Emergencies

🚨

Snapped torsion or extension springs – The most common garage door emergency. A broken spring causes the door to become extremely heavy and unsafe to operate. Do not attempt to open or close it.

🚨

Door off its tracks – If the door has jumped the track, it is dangerous and can fall. Do not try to force it back. This requires an experienced professional.

🚨

Broken cables – Steel cables under high tension can snap suddenly. A dangling cable means the door is unstable and could fall without warning.

🚨

Storm or impact damage – High winds, falling debris, or vehicle impact can bend panels, damage tracks, or knock the door out of alignment. If the door won't seal or operate, get help.

🚨

Door stuck open or closed – A door stuck open leaves your home or garage unsecured. A door stuck closed can trap vehicles or block access. Both need same-day attention.

🚨

Opener malfunction with door stuck – If the opener fails and the emergency release won't disengage, or if the door is under tension, professional help is needed.

Local Weather Risks in Seligman

🌪️

Triggers

Severe thunderstorms with straight-line winds or hail can dent panels and misalign tracks. Winter freezing rain and snow can ice up bottom seals, freeze tracks, and overload torsion springs. Rapid temperature swings — common in the Ozarks — can cause metal components to contract and expand, leading to spring fatigue or breakage.

📅

Seasonal Risks

Emergency garage door calls in the Seligman area tend to spike during spring thunderstorm season (March–June) and winter ice events (December–February). High winds, heavy snow, and ice buildup can stress doors, tracks, and openers.

🏚️

Disaster Scenarios

Post-storm: After a severe thunderstorm or tornado warning passes, garage doors may have impact damage, bent tracks, or broken panels. High winds can pull doors off their tracks entirely. Ice/freeze: Prolonged freezing rain can ice doors shut. Attempting to force an iced door can break springs or damage the opener. Flood: Flash flooding in low-lying areas near creeks or drainage zones can warp bottom panels, rust tracks, and damage openers and sensors.

Emergency Prevention Tips

  • Test your door monthly – If the door doesn't reverse when it meets resistance (place a small block on the ground), the safety sensors may need adjustment. A malfunctioning auto-reverse is a safety hazard.
  • Lubricate moving parts twice a year – Use a silicone-based lubricant on rollers, hinges, and tracks. Avoid grease, which attracts dirt and causes wear.
  • Visually inspect springs and cables – Look for rust, gaps in coils, or fraying cables. Catching wear early can prevent a sudden break.
  • Clear snow and ice from the bottom seal – Before operating the door in winter, ensure the bottom seal is not frozen to the ground. Forcing it can damage the seal, the door, or the opener.
  • Keep tracks clean and aligned – Debris or bent tracks cause binding. If you notice scraping sounds or uneven movement, call a professional before the problem worsens.
  • Know your emergency release – Learn how to use the manual release cord (usually red) so you can disengage the opener in a power outage. Test it once per year.

Can you fix a garage door spring the same day?

In most cases, yes. Torsion and extension springs are commonly stocked items for local garage door professionals. A snapped spring is considered an emergency and is usually prioritized for same-day repair.

What if my garage door won't open and my car is trapped inside?

This is a genuine emergency. First, do not attempt to force the door. Use the manual release cord if you can reach it. If the door is under tension or off-track, call for professional help. Local providers regularly handle stuck-door situations.

Is a noisy garage door an emergency?

Generally no. Noisy operation — squeaking, grinding, or rattling — is usually a maintenance issue, not an emergency. However, if the noise is accompanied by jerky movement or the door stops working mid-cycle, it should be checked soon.

Will my home insurance cover garage door damage?

Many homeowners insurance policies cover damage from storms, vehicle impact, or vandalism. Wear-and-tear issues like broken springs are typically not covered. Check with your insurer for specifics. Local professionals can provide repair estimates for insurance claims.

What should I do while I wait for the repair professional?

Stay clear of the door. Do not attempt to operate it. If the door is partially open and the area is accessible, secure the opening with plywood or a tarp if possible. Keep children and pets away from the door area.
